PEOPLE v. MARRERO


83 A.D.2d 565 (1981)

The People of the State of New York, Appellant, v. Edwin Marrero and Edgar Marrero, Respondents

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Second Department.

July 6, 1981


Order affirmed.

The evidence at the posttrial hearing established that prior to deliberations the jurors and alternate jurors engaged in extensive discussions of the evidence in the case, the credibility of the evidence, the nature of the neighborhood where the crimes occurred, the involvement of defendants and witnesses in street gangs, and the purported characteristics of Puerto Rican street gangs.
